For a 1000W inverter, the ideal battery setup depends on your budget and usage: Go with one 12V 100Ah lithium battery if you want long life and high efficiency. Choose four 12V 100Ah lead-acid batteries if you're on a tighter budget. Proper battery sizing ensures your inverter runs smoothly, saves energy, and extends the life of your batteries.
A 24V battery can also be used if your solar panel has the right voltage. A 12V 100ah lithium battery, including the Weize LiFePO4 can supply1200 watts if fully discharged (which you can do).
